Backbone Bootstrap CRM

Overview

Backbone Bootstrap CRM, code named bbCRM, is a backend agnostic, single page web app for listing and managing your site or app's users.

Set up

Setting up bbCRM is easy, here we used Flask (a Python framework) as an example.

  • Step 1: Clone this repo to your local machine: git clone https://github.com/benjamin21st/backbonecrm
  • Step 2: cd into the backbonecrm directory, and initiate a virtual environment by running: virtualenv env (of course you can replace env with any name you want for the virtual environment)
  • Step 3: Activate virtual environment by running: source env/bin/activate on Unix machines (Mac or Linux distributions), or source env/scripts/activate on Windows machines
  • Step 4: Install basic dependency -- the Flask framework by running pip install -r requirements.txt
  • Step 5: Run simple server with code: python api.py

Then if you navigate your browser to Localhost:5001 and you should see a list of dummy users.

Develop

To develop BBCRM, in addition to the steps mentioned earlier in order to get it running, you also need to have the following installed in your dev environment:

  1. node and npm
  2. bower

Issues

It still requires Bower components to be able to show styles and stuff. Make it more self-containing by using CDN or minified scripts.
